Marine Products Corporation‘s stocks are currently a part of 39 hedge funds’ portfolios, which represents 9.13% of the total amount of its stocks outstanding. This makes up a total of 3.05M shares of Marine Products Corporation. Compared to the previous quarter, the number fell by -34.08% or -1.57M shares fewer. As for the holding position changes, 35.9% (14) of current hedge fund investors increased the number of shares held, 33.33% (13) of current holders sold a part of the shares held, and 2.56% (1) closed the holdings completely. 2 hedge funds are new holders of Marine Products Corporation stock in Q1 2023, it is 5.13% of total holders.
